Documented differences
| Decision | Mirra 2 | Gesture |
|---|---|---|
| Seat and back | AireWeave suspension seat; TriFlex or Butterfly back. | Foam seat with flexible edges. Check upholstery and back configuration. |
| Seat depth and recline | Fixed-depth and FlexFront options are listed, along with different tilt packages. | Controls adjust seat height, depth, recline tension and variable back stops. |
| Headrest and arms | The cited specification page does not list a factory headrest. Arm configurations vary. | An integrated headrest is an option. Articulated, fixed-arm and armless configurations are listed. |
Sources: Mirra 2 manufacturer specifications and Gesture manufacturer features. Regional specifications and configurations can differ; match the documentation to the offered chair.
A focused trial
On Mirra 2, verify the back type and whether the trial chair includes FlexFront. Test front-edge clearance at your working seat height. On Gesture, position the arms for keyboard and tablet use and try the back stops. If considering a headrest, test that configuration upright and reclined rather than assuming an accessory can be fitted later.
Keep your normal desk, footwear and keyboard position in mind. Check foot support and arm clearance before comparing upright and reclined positions. Standing height alone cannot settle fit.
Evidence limits
This comparison has not measured cooling, medical outcomes, resale returns or long-term failure rates. We do not infer a health benefit or a reliability winner from isolated owner anecdotes. A higher aggregate rating is not enough to predict your experience.
Compare complete offers
Ask for the exact model, configuration, condition, upholstery and destination. Include delivery, taxes, return freight and trial restrictions. Confirm warranty eligibility and the service provider in your country, especially for imported or refurbished chairs. No fixed price gap or warranty winner has been verified here.
For used chairs, inspect the actual seat, arms and adjustment mechanisms. For new chairs, match the order to the configuration you tried; a less expensive listing may contain different equipment.

Frequently asked
- Does every Mirra 2 have adjustable seat depth?
- No. Fixed-depth and FlexFront adjustable-depth configurations are listed. Confirm the actual offer.
- Can Gesture be ordered with a headrest?
- Yes. Steelcase lists an integrated headrest option. Not every Gesture includes it, and this does not establish later retrofit compatibility.
- Is Mirra 2 more durable than Gesture?
- We have not established comparative failure rates. Isolated owner reports and ratings do not justify a model-wide durability verdict.
